National Bank Celebrates the 30th Anniversary of Just For Laughs Festival
National Bank is delighted to take part in the festivities marking the 30th edition of the Just For Laughs Festival by presenting two items on the festival’s 2012 programme: the Théâtre Juste pour rire tour and three series of English-language shows: the National Bank Club Series, National Bank Special Event Series and National Bank Comicpro Series.
“National Bank is proud to join in the celebration of Just for Laugh’s 30th anniversary. For three decades now, the Festival has been expanding on its core programming to reach an even larger audience. Similarly, National Bank’s participation this year is also multi-faceted, involving both the English- and French-language programmes of the Festival.

The most popular English-speaking comedians from Canada and the United States
Between July 10 and 28, the Bank will be presenting three series of shows in Montreal showcasing the most popular English-speaking comedians from Canada and the United States.
National Bank will also be partnering for a third time with the Théâtre Juste pour rire to put on “Double Vie,” the French-language version of a play by British playwright Ray Cooney.
The play, which has been performed around the world, has been adapted and staged for a local audience by Normand Chouinard. The Quebec version is playing at the Théâtre Juste pour rire in Bromont this July and August, and at 17 other venues across the province until December.
Street Arts
In addition, the Bank will be presenting the Street Arts portion of the Festival, which features performers and artists taking to the streets between July 14 and 28.
